Sony WH-1000XM5 Headphones Launch With New Features

Sony has officially launched its highly anticipated WH-1000XM5 noise-cancelling headphones, marking a significant upgrade from their predecessors, the WH-1000XM4. The new model boasts a completely redesigned chassis, moving away from the foldable design of previous generations to a more streamlined, single-piece construction. This aesthetic shift contributes to a lighter and more comfortable wearing experience, according to Sony's product announcements. The headphones are now available for purchase at a retail price of $399.99 in the United States, positioning them at the premium end of the consumer audio market.

Key technological advancements in the WH-1000XM5 include enhanced noise cancellation capabilities, driven by the integration of two processors and eight microphones. Sony claims these improvements result in significantly better performance, particularly in mid- and high-frequency ranges, which are often challenging for noise-cancelling technology. The headphones utilize an "Auto NC Optimizer" that automatically adjusts noise cancellation based on the user's environment and wearing conditions, a feature designed to provide a more seamless and effective noise-blocking experience. Furthermore, the WH-1000XM5 incorporates "Speak-to-Chat" technology, which automatically pauses music and allows ambient sound in when the user begins speaking, a convenience feature carried over and refined from earlier models.

In terms of audio quality, the WH-1000XM5 features new 30mm drivers, a departure from the 40mm drivers found in the XM4. Sony states these new drivers are designed to deliver improved sound reproduction, particularly in the higher frequencies, contributing to a more detailed and clear listening experience. The headphones also support High-Resolution Audio Wireless through LDAC, ensuring high-quality audio streaming from compatible devices. Battery life remains a strong point, with Sony claiming up to 30 hours of playback with noise cancelling enabled and up to 40 hours with it turned off. A quick charge feature provides 3 hours of playback from just a 3-minute charge via USB-C.

The WH-1000XM5 also introduces multipoint Bluetooth connectivity, allowing users to connect to two devices simultaneously and switch between them seamlessly. This is a notable improvement for users who frequently juggle between a smartphone and a laptop or tablet. The headphones are built with sustainability in mind, with Sony utilizing recycled plastic materials in their construction and packaging. The product is available in two color options: Black and Silver. The launch positions Sony to continue its dominance in the premium wireless headphone market, competing with offerings from brands like Bose and Apple.
